Courtesy Call is a firm that provides fundraising services, telemarketing, professional and technical services, and direct mail to nonprofit clients. They primarily provide their services regionally, with most clients in Florida, Nevada, and Tennessee (although they are present in other states as well).
Most Courtesy Call clients are outpatient health care practitioners and facilities, emergency and relief services, health and disease research fundraising organizations, and civic and social organizations with revenues ranging from $834,547 to $4.7 million.
